She became the first Indian singer to win a YouTube Diamond Award in 2021..

Neha Kakkar enjoys a huge fan following in India and is often referred to as the "Indian Shakira" by her fans. She began her career in Bollywood as a chorus singer, and soon rose to fame with her dance track "Second Hand Jawaani" in the 2012 film 'Cocktail'. She never had to look back since then, and went ahead to sing several hit songs along the way.

Over the last few years, Neha has carved a niche with her remixes of iconic Hindi songs. Although these have been opposed by some, there's no arguing that the masses are in love with her tracks. Aashiq Banaya Aapne

Neha Kakkar recreated the melodious song "Aashiq Banaya Aapne" (from the film 'Aashiq Banaya Aapne') for the fourth installment of 'Hate Story'. She used only the hook line of the original song here and replaced the magical voice of Shreya Ghoshal.

The song received criticism for "ruining the melody and turning it into a club dance number". However, it currently has 25 crore views on YouTube.

O Saki Saki

The original "O Saki Saki" song is from the 2004 film 'Musafir', sung by Sukhwinder Singh and Sunidhi Chauhan.

Neha Kakkar remade the song for the film 'Batla House’, featuring Nora Fatehi.

Koena Mitra, who performed the original number, called the new version a 'mess'. She said, "Nora has got good skills, she’s a lovely dancer. What I didn’t understand is what they (the makers) have done to our song. I honestly didn’t like the soundtrack, not even the visuals. They could have shot it in a better way, the way Sanjay had shot the video. It’s still fresh in our memory, it’s not yet an old song. It was too early to kill this song with an average song (recreation)."

However, the recreated version has 69 crore views on YouTube.
